Yet Another Gertaera hargailuen Araztu Trick

I’m sure I’m not the first person to come up with this. Hala eta guztiz ere, I haven’t noticed anyone publish a trick like this since I started paying close attention to the community last July. Beraz,, Hau da, azkarra eta erraza arazketa punta bidaltzeko nuela pentsatu nuen.

Gertaera baten hartzailea duten hasi akats hau sortzeko nabil 12 hive:

Errorea kargatu eta exekutatzen gertaera hartzailea xyzzy en Conchango.xyzzyEventReceiver, 1.0.0.0 bertsioa =, Kultura = neutrala, PublicKeyToken = blahbalhbalh. Additional information is below. : Objektu erreferentzia ez objektu baten instantzia bat ezarri.

I didn’t know where I had introduced this bug because I had done too many things in one of my code/deploy/test cycles.

Saiatu dut irtenbide hau nire pdb lortzeko hor itxaropen dituzten SharePoint-en 12 hive automatikoa erakutsiko luke, but no luck. I don’t know if it’s possible and if someone does, please let me know 🙂

Posible al da, ezagutzen dut idatzi, zure log mezuak 12 hive. Frankly, Zerbait apur bat gutxiago scary eta azkarrago ezartzea nahi dut.

Gertatu zait ezin dudala gutxienez lortu zenbait aztarna oinarrizko informazioa eta harrapatzeko berriro bota hau bezalako salbuespenak by generic:

  saiatu {
    UpdateEditionDate(propietate);
  }
  harrapatzeko (Salbuespen eta)
  {
    bota berria Salbuespen("Dispatcher, UpdateEditionDate(): Salbuespen: [" + e.ToString() + "].");
  }

Honek erakutsi du parte 12 hive thusly:

Errorea kargatu eta exekutatzen gertaera hartzailea xyzzy en Conchango.xyzzyEventReceiver, 1.0.0.0 bertsioa =, Kultura = neutrala, PublicKeyToken = blahblahblah. Additional information is below. : Aztergailu, UpdateEditionDate(): Salbuespen: [System.NullReferenceException: Objektu erreferentzia ez objektu baten instantzia bat ezarri. at Conchango.xyzzyManagementEventReceiver.UpdateEditionDate(SPItemEventProperties propietate) at Conchango.xyzzyManagementEventReceiver.Dispatcher(SPItemEventProperties propietate, Katea eventDescription)].

Eman zidan xehetasun behera jarraitzeko bereziki arazo hori behar nuen guztia, eta erabili asko aurrera joatea espero dut.

</amaiera>

Nire blog Harpidetu!

3 buruzko gogoeta "Yet Another Gertaera hargailuen Araztu Trick

  1. Anders Rask
    Izan dut zorte alot azkenaldian gai mota hau arazteko SPTraceView eta DebugView konbinazio batekin
    Debugview bakarrik, oso erabilgarria baita. Irteera System.Diagnostics.Debug.WriteLine erabiliz kanalizazioa ahal duzu().
    Are dont duzu zertan kendu eraikitzeko askatu duzu, irteera bakarra da noiztik eraikitze arazketa modua aktibatzen.
    SPTraceView is a tool created by Hristo Pavlov.
    Bere berezko ezarpena Erakutsi aztarna gertakari Uls duzu gertatuko dira izango. Eta, gainera, harrapatu du Uls arrastorik gertakari * horrek ez * egin da diagnostiko erregistroa!
    Baina desgaitu i bezain laster abiarazi i erabilgarriak du. Whats askoz hobe dezakezu irteera kanalizazioa sortu erakusteko DebugView en.
    Gainera, ezaugarri nice alot gertaera mailatan iragazteko, zerbitzuak, eta abar.
    hth
    Ez bezala
    oh and nice seeing you in the bar at SPBP 🙂
    Erantzun
  2. Charles

    Hobeto oraindik, Enterprise Liburutegia gehitzea edo log4net bezala liburutegia saioa amaitzeko, eta nahiz eta zure bizitza errazagoa izango da.

    Erantzun

Utzi iruzkin bat Charles Utzi erantzuna

Zure e-posta helbidea ez da argitaratuko. Beharrezko eremuak markatu dira *